RGB图像加密压缩:广义骑士巡游方法

需积分: 0 0 下载量 25 浏览量 更新于2024-08-05 收藏 882KB PDF 举报
"基于广义骑士巡游的RGB图像加密压缩算法_刘博文1" 本文介绍了一种结合广义骑士巡游置乱加密技术与JPEG压缩的RGB图像加密压缩算法,由刘博文等人提出。该算法关注图像在保密传输中的安全性和效率问题。首先,它将原始的RGB图像转换为YCbCr色彩空间,这是因为YCbCr色彩模型在保持图像视觉质量的同时,能够更好地进行压缩处理。 在YCbCr色彩空间中,算法将图像分为8x8的块,并对每一层进行离散余弦变换(DCT)。DCT是图像压缩中常用的工具,它能够将图像数据转换为频域表示,便于去除冗余信息。接下来,算法构建了一个以块为单位的三维棋盘结构,这是为了应用广义骑士巡游规则。广义骑士巡游是一种数学上的置换方式,类似国际象棋中的马移动,但允许马在棋盘上跳过更多的格子,增加了置换的复杂性和随机性,从而提高加密的难度和安全性。 在三维棋盘上应用广义骑士巡游置乱规则,使得图像块的位置和内容被混淆,极大地增强了加密效果。最后,经过加密的块被进一步用JPEG标准进行压缩,生成加密压缩图像。JPEG是一种有损压缩方法,能够在牺牲一定图像质量的前提下,大幅度减小文件大小,适合于网络传输或存储。 通过仿真验证和实验分析,该算法显示了良好的图像压缩性能,对图像的压缩效果影响较小,同时提高了压缩效率。在保证一定安全性的前提下,该方法有效地结合了图像加密和压缩,为涉密图像的安全传输提供了一种解决方案。关键词包括RGB图像加密、广义骑士巡游置乱以及分块处理,这些都揭示了算法的核心特点和所涉及的技术领域。 该研究为图像安全传输提供了一种创新的方法,利用广义骑士巡游的数学特性增强加密强度,同时结合JPEG压缩技术优化了传输效率。这种综合策略在确保信息安全的同时,兼顾了传输的便捷性,对于实际应用具有重要意义。